The original establishment of the Miyazawa chain of kappo restaurants. Jiki Miyazawa is best known for its famous baked sesame tofu, accompanied by rice served at its freshest, right after cooking. Other menu items are conceived by the chef, drawing on his experience at the ambassador’s residence in Poland. Each dish is layered with numerous ingredients, brightened by the freshness of citrus and tartness of other fruits. In true gourmet fashion, soba dishes are crafted using seasonal ingredients.
